FLW Tour New Record Set After Day 1

July 11, 2008 by Don Zaegel  
Filed under Sports Rumors

     After day 1 of the final event of the FLW Tour regular season, a new FLW Tour record was set with a new total day weight. Pros and Co-Anglers combined, hauled in 5,137 pounds and 6 ounces of bass breaking the previous weight record set on Lake Champlain in 2006 by 262 pounds. Most of the bigger bags are coming out of Lake St. Clair rather than Lake Erie.

     Local Pro and favorite, Vic Vatalaro caught the big bag of the day with 21-11 lbs. “I couldn’t get Erie to do the job so I changed up and went to St.Clair instead”, Vatalaro said. The 2nd, 3rd, and 4th place weights all came from Erie.

     The FLW Tour has been relatively quiet all year long, not making much noise and seemingly fishing events that have produced mild weights by comparison to the Elite Series. The drama of the AOY race and the Forrest Wood Cup cut this weekend, all topped off with record setting catches, is just what the FLW Tour needs to end the season on a high note.
